#c018c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c018cd is composed of 75.3% red, 9.4%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.3% cyan, 88.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 295.7 degrees, a saturation of 79% and a lightness of 44.9%. #c018cd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30ff with #81009b.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#c018c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c018cd has RGB values of R:192, G:24,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 12589261.
